Supreme Court of Iowa
Planned Parenthood of the Heartland, Inc., Emma Goldman Clinic, and Sarah Traxler M.D. v. Kim Reynolds ex rel. State…
June 28, 2024
Summary
The court held that abortion restrictions challenged under the Iowa Constitution's due process clause are subject to rational-basis review because abortion is not a fundamental right under the Iowa Constitution. Applying that deferential standard, the court concluded that the fetal-heartbeat statute is rationally related to legitimate state interests and therefore that the plaintiffs could not show a likelihood of success supporting a temporary injunction. The court also upheld the plaintiffs' standing and the ripeness of the action, while declining to consider constitutional claims not pursued on appeal.
